What Exactly Is a Simplex Pump Setup?
At its core, a simplex system uses one pump to manage your building’s water flow and maintain consistent pressure.
Think of it as the workhorse that activates automatically when pressure drops or flow demands increase, then shuts down once the system stabilizes.
How Single Pump Configurations Work
Most NYC installations rely on either pressure sensors or float switches to trigger operation.
The beauty of this single pump configuration lies in its straightforward design:
- Fewer components mean fewer things that can go wrong
- Less complexity translates to lower maintenance overhead
- Simplified troubleshooting when issues arise
- Easier staff training for building maintenance teams

The Fundamental Difference
The fundamental distinction comes down to redundancy:
- Simplex systems depend entirely on that single pump staying operational
- Duplex setups give you two pumps that can alternate operation or provide backup when one needs service

Essential Maintenance Tasks
Regular inspections should cover several key areas:
- Motor performance monitoring and testing
- Impeller condition inspection and cleaning
- Electrical control functionality verification
- Pressure response testing at various demand levels
- Sensor accuracy checks and calibration
Test pressure response to ensure the system activates at the correct setpoints.
Check sensors for accuracy and calibration drift, which is common in NYC’s varying environmental conditions.

Maintenance Schedules
Preventive maintenance schedules vary by building type:
- Most commercial properties: Quarterly inspections
- High-demand facilities: Monthly attention
- Lighter-use buildings: Semi-annual service
Keep detailed logs of pump cycles, pressure readings, and maintenance activities.
These records help identify developing problems before they cause failures and provide valuable data when you’re evaluating whether system upgrades make sense.

Variable Frequency Drives
Consider variable frequency drives (VFDs) for buildings with fluctuating demand.
VFDs let your pump modulate speed to match actual need rather than running at full capacity.
Potential energy savings: 30% or more in the right applications

Warning Signs You Need an Upgrade
Watch for these indicators:
- Pump runs continuously throughout the day
- Cycles too frequently (more than once per hour)
- Pressure drops during peak use periods
- Tenant complaints about water pressure
- Maintenance requirements increasing steadily
- System struggles with excessive workload
Upgrade Path to Duplex
When these patterns emerge, upgrading to duplex configurations provides the reliability and capacity your growing property needs.
The transition often involves adding a second pump to your existing infrastructure, which costs less than complete system replacement.
